This handsome antique hip flask is glass and silver plated with its upper half wrapped in a lovely dark brown leather that contrasts the silver plate perfectly. The silver-plated bottom doubles up as a removable drinking cup. The hinged top of the flask is of the bayonet locking type. Both the neck of the flask and the removable drinking cup are marked ‘J D & S’ for James Dickson & Sons – Sheffield, England.
Measurements:
Height: 5 3/4" (approx. 14.5cm)
Width: 2 3/4" (approx. 7cm)
Depth: 1 1/8" (approx. 3cm)
Total weight: 260g
In good condition – any dark areas are shadows from the photography.
